When the liquid flow increases, the luminal caliber's stretching amplitude decreases, leading to a higher hydraulic pressure according to Poiseuille's law. In this study, investigators measured the caliber change of the popliteal vein under a rated pressure gradient and evaluated the relationship between popliteal vein compliance and venous clinical severity score (VCSS).
